Summary of metal fabrications

Metalworking is a highly specialized industry and those considered fabricators are expected to have a thorough knowledge of metals, their properties and how to properly process them. Machining involves interactive evaluation of vehicles and chassis, company research, welding supervision, and working with heavy machinery and large industrial structures. Metalworkers use raw materials, machines, and blueprints to craft a variety of items, all the way down to spare parts. As a fabricator, you should expect to work in a manufacturing facility and most of the time you may be standing or sitting for long periods of time. During the week, you may be working an average of 40 hours per week at work. The highest paying jobs in metalworking.

As a metal fabricator, a variety of career options are open to you. Most of these jobs are related to building and crafting various items needed to build and craft other metal structures. They are also involved in maintenance and repairs.
